Get matched in Lancaster County →A good hospice can often begin within 24–48 hours of the referral. If care is needed now, call two or three providers — responsiveness on this call predicts responsiveness later.
Ask for specifics: visits per week, weekend coverage, and what actually happens when the family calls overnight.
Yes — Medicare's hospice benefit covers the hospice team, comfort medications, equipment, and respite care. Room and board is the main cost it does not cover.
